KazuriAmerica.com sells handmade jewelry made by African women in Kenya. The Kazuri name, which is Swahili for “small and beautiful,” was started in 1975, so they’ve been around a while. Millennium Promise is the organization that actually does the dirty work when it comes to helping the poor in Africa.  In fact another post about the OmniPeace tees gives their profit to this organization.  I like this line from their mission statement “Our work is premised on the belief that, for the first time in history, our generation has the opportunity to end extreme poverty, hunger, and disease.”  They have many other supporters in addition to their current campaigns to raise money.  Millennium promise is in 80 different villages in 10 African countries.

Thought I should add this to the collection. Product Red if you’re unfamiliar is an effort to end AIDS in Africa by selling products that are….well…red. The companies give a certain amount 5-10% generally to the global fund. omnipeace teeBesides having one of the greatest logos for peace organizations, OmniPeace makes some great T-Shirts to end poverty and raise awareness in violent Sub-Saharan Africa. The company donates half the proceeds from a $25-$30 shirt to the non profit Millenium Promise.
